Volunteer jobs available at Mercy Corps' U.S. headquarters in Portland, Oregon, are as diverse as our array of paid positions - and only slightly easier to land. One important exception: no volunteer positions are available overseas.

About half of our volunteers perform office work in the agency's operations division; others conduct research for program staff or help out with general office tasks in finance, human resources or another department.

If you are interested in helping out at Mercy Corps, please download, complete and return our volunteer application. We will share your background, skills and availability with our Portland-based staff. If your qualifications meet the requirements needed to fill a specific volunteer position in their area, they will give you a call.

If there is not an appropriate position available and you do not receive a call, please contact us one month after sending in your application and we will post the information again. We will keep your resume and application on file in an ongoing volunteer pool.

You are encouraged to contact us once a month so we can repost your application. This increases your chances of matching with new positions as they arise.

Volunteer positions at Mercy Corps are unpaid and there should be no expectation of future employment when volunteering for Mercy Corps.

At this time, we do not have a formal overseas internship or volunteer program. When this kind of opportunity arises, it will be posted in the Jobs section of our website. The only volunteer opportunities at Mercy Corps are at our Portland, Oregon headquarters.

If you are interested in volunteering overseas, we suggest you contact Interaction, an "umbrella" agency with about 160 member non-governmental organizations. Although InterAction does not hire for positions with any of their members, they publish a useful book entitled Interaction Member Profiles. This guide lists their members, with information about scope of work, geographical locations and contact information.
